14 lines
450 B
TypeScript
14 lines
450 B
TypeScript
import { useSafeQuery } from '@/hooks/use-safe-query';
|
|
import { getTrainingStatisticsAction } from '../actions/training-actions';
|
|
|
|
export function useTrainingStatsQuery(params: {
|
|
startDate?: string;
|
|
endDate?: string;
|
|
stateId?: number;
|
|
municipalityId?: number;
|
|
parishId?: number;
|
|
ospType?: string;
|
|
} = {}) {
|
|
return useSafeQuery(['training-statistics', JSON.stringify(params)], () => getTrainingStatisticsAction(params));
|
|
}
|